Yes, at long last, here it is.  To run it, just:

	add library
	librarydemo

This must be run from an Athena workstation; we don't yet have a
tty-based interface for it.  You'll get a window with cascading menus,
just like Dash.  Click any mouse button over the name of an item you'd
like to execute, and it will start up. (Note that only those items
with an asterisk to the left of their names currently execute
something.)  Any menu item which has an arrow to its right is the
label for another menu; just click on the arrow to bring up the lower
menu.  Click any mouse button on any "?" to the right of any menu item
to see the help for that item.

Please note that the services are all in an experimental state, and
that there are many holes in the menu tree.  I'll talk specifically
about each menu item below.

----------------------------description of menu items-----------------------

News and Information:

	Library News -- currently points to the TechInfo text about
			CD Barton, in the /mit/mitlibs/info directory.

	Library Information -- currently this points to the TechInfo
			text about the libraries' term hours and 
			locations.  

	Libray Help:

		Look at Answers Database -- not yet available; 
			eventually this will point to the 
			"stock answers" from OWL.  

		How to Search...
		 Pathfinders, etc. -- Not yet available.

Barton:

	Barton -- connects the the library.mit.edu Barton interface.

	New Books List -- Not yet available

Library Forms:

	(All these currently don't start any application, pending the
	decision on just how to do this.)

Databases:

	(Currently contains placeholders for Medline and Table of 
	Contents, neither of which are yet net-accessible from Athena.)

Other Libraries:

	Boston Library Consortium Serials List;
	Harvard (HOLLIS);
	Berkeley (Melvyl);
	Boston University;
		
		    --	All these connect directly to the named
			catalogs.  These are here to mimic the behavior
			of the "setup library" application.  

	Library Catalogs -- This runs a script that connects
			the user to a huge list of library card catalogs
			and campus information systems.
